A varicocele is an abnormal tortuosity and dilation of veins of the pampiniform plexus within the spermatic cord. The exact connection between varicoceles and infertility is unclear, but the most commonly accepted theory is that varicoceles increase scrotal temperature, which negatively affects spermatogenesis A homoeopathic constitutional treatment will give you a permanent cure naturally You can easily take an online consultation for further treatment guidance Medicines will reach you via courier services

Hello, the complaint of varicocele arises when the veins around your scrotum become engorged and torturous. Semen infection is a different complaint. They do not seem to be directly linked.
